An assisted living apartment is typically a private unit within a larger community, designed for seniors who need some help with daily activities but do not require intensive, 24-hour medical care. Think of it as a maintenance-free lifestyle. Your loved one would have their own space—often with a kitchenette, private bathroom, and room for personal furnishings—while the community handles chores like housekeeping, laundry, and home maintenance. The defining feature is the available personal care assistance, which can include help with bathing, dressing, medication management, and mobility. This support is tailored individually, meaning the care plan adapts as needs change, providing peace of mind for families.

As you begin visiting potential assisted living apartments in Moore County, we recommend coming with a list of thoughtful questions. Inquire about staff training and ratios, the process for handling medical emergencies, and how care plans are regularly reviewed. Ask to sample a meal and observe an activity to gauge the atmosphere. It’s also prudent to discuss the fee structure in detail, understanding what is included in the base rate and what services might incur additional costs. Don’t hesitate to talk to current residents and their families about their experiences; their insights are often the most valuable.
